You connected your wallet to a website that looked legitimate and approved something you thought was necessary. Maybe you were claiming an airdrop, minting an NFT, swapping tokens, or joining a DeFi platform.
Then your tokens started disappearing.
This is different from simply sending crypto to a scammer. You may have signed a token approval that gave a smart contract permission to spend specific assets from your wallet. The approval itself may not have moved your tokens, but it can provide the permission later used to transfer them.
The useful questions now are what you approved, which token permissions were granted, which transaction actually removed your assets, where those assets went afterward, and whether the wallet still has dangerous permissions active.

STOP INTERACTING WITH THE SUSPICIOUS WEBSITE


Don’t reconnect to the website just to investigate what happened. Don’t sign another transaction because it claims the previous one needs to be reversed or completed.
If tokens are still disappearing, prioritize securing whatever remains in the wallet. If you believe the wallet itself has been compromised, moving remaining assets to a newly created secure wallet may be appropriate rather than continuing to use the compromised one. MetaMask’s compromised-wallet guidance
Never give anyone your seed phrase or private key because they claim it is needed to recover the tokens.

FIND THE ORIGINAL APPROVAL


Look up the transaction you signed when you clicked Approve, Confirm, or a similar button.
Record:
network → token → approved spender → allowance → contract address → timestamp → transaction hash.
The important distinction is that an approval and a token transfer are not necessarily the same transaction.
For example:
Transaction 1: approval granted
Transaction 2: tokens transferred
The first may explain how permission was obtained. The second shows what actually left your wallet.
Token approvals can remain active until they are revoked or otherwise changed, depending on the token and contract. Etherscan’s token-approval guidance
Once you’ve identified the approval, check whether that permission is still active.


CHECK FOR ACTIVE TOKEN PERMISSIONS


Review the wallet’s approvals for the relevant network.
Look for:
unknown spender → recent approval → large allowance → token you actually hold.
Disconnecting from the website is not necessarily the same as revoking an approval. An existing token permission can remain even after the dapp connection is removed. MetaMask’s dapp guidance
If you identify a suspicious active approval, revoke it using a trusted tool and verify the resulting transaction yourself. Etherscan and Revoke.cash both provide approval-checking tools for supported networks. Revoke.cash
Remember: revoking an approval can prevent future use of that permission, but it does not reverse a token transfer that already happened.

IDENTIFY THE TOKEN-DRAIN TRANSACTION


Go to the wallet’s transaction history or the relevant block explorer.
Find the transaction where the missing tokens actually moved.
Record:
transaction hash → token → amount → sending wallet → receiving address → contract involved → timestamp.
For example:
Approval → USDT permission granted
Later transfer → 18,500 USDT leaves wallet
That distinction is critical.
You don’t want to investigate only the approval and assume it tells the complete story. You need to identify the actual asset movement.
Once you’ve found the drain transaction, follow the tokens beyond the first receiving address.


FOLLOW THE TOKENS AFTER THE DRAIN


The receiving address may only be the first destination.
The stolen assets may subsequently be:
Wallet A → Wallet B → token swap → Wallet C
or:
Token transfer → Wallet A → Wallet D → exchange
Several stolen transfers may also converge:
Transfer 1 → Address A → Address D
Transfer 2 → Address B → Address D
Transfer 3 → Address C → Address D
The purpose is to reconstruct what happened after the tokens left your wallet, not simply identify the first address.
If the assets were swapped, bridged, or moved across networks, those later transactions become additional parts of the trail.

CONNECT THE APPROVAL TO THE TOKEN LOSS


Build the transaction sequence using timestamps:
suspicious website → wallet connection → approval → token drain → subsequent movement.
If the approval occurred at 2:14 PM and the unauthorized transfer occurred at 2:16 PM, that timing is relevant.
If the tokens disappeared several days later, examine what other approvals or transactions occurred between those events.
Don’t automatically assume that the suspicious website caused every transaction. Establish the actual sequence first.


CHECK WHETHER MORE THAN ONE ASSET WAS AFFECTED


Don’t stop after finding one missing token.
Review the wallet for:


  • Other token transfers
  • NFT transfers
  • Additional approvals
  • setApprovalForAll activity
  • Unrecognized swaps
  • Bridge transactions
  • Unknown contract interactions
  • Transfers immediately before or after the main drain
    A malicious interaction may affect more than one asset or leave additional permissions active.
    Once you’ve checked the surrounding activity, determine whether the wallet itself or only a particular approval is at issue.

APPROVAL PROBLEM VS. WALLET COMPROMISE


These situations should not be treated as identical.
Approval issue: You signed a malicious approval, and the attacker later used that permission to move an approved token.
Wallet compromise: Someone obtained broader control of the wallet or its signing credentials and can potentially authorize transactions directly.
If you suspect the private key or seed phrase was exposed, revoking one approval may not be enough. A new secure wallet may be necessary for remaining assets. MetaMask’s compromised-wallet guidance
This distinction matters because the security response can be different.


WHAT IF THE TOKENS WERE SWAPPED?


The stolen asset may no longer appear in the same form.
For example:
USDC stolen → swapped for ETH → ETH sent to another wallet.
Or:
Token stolen → DEX swap → USDT → second wallet.
Don’t stop the investigation because the original token balance is gone.
Follow the subsequent transactions and record each conversion or transfer.


WHAT IF THE MALICIOUS CONTRACT IS STILL HOLDING ASSETS?


Don’t interact with it simply because you see a balance.
First establish whether the asset is actually recoverable from that contract and whether interacting with it would create additional risk.
Don’t sign another transaction from the same suspicious website because someone says it will release the tokens.

WHAT CAN BLOCKCHAIN TRACING TELL YOU ABOUT RECOVERY?


Tracing can potentially establish:
what permission was granted → which token was affected → which transaction removed it → where the asset moved → whether later transactions connect to other addresses or identifiable services.
That can turn a vague wallet-drain incident into a documented transaction sequence.
But tracing the tokens does not automatically mean they can be returned.
The outcome can depend on subsequent movements, available evidence, identifiable intermediaries, and what investigative or legal avenues are available.
Be cautious of anyone promising guaranteed recovery simply because they have identified the attacker’s wallet. A wallet address is evidence, not proof that the funds can be recovered.
The practical sequence is:
secure → preserve → identify approval → identify drain → revoke remaining permissions → trace funds → connect evidence → assess realistic recovery options.
